Allison Thompson is a scholar working on Epidemiology, Microbiology and Surgery. According to data from OpenAlex, Allison Thompson has authored 36 papers receiving a total of 524 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 25 papers in Epidemiology, 8 papers in Microbiology and 7 papers in Surgery. Recurrent topics in Allison Thompson’s work include Pneumonia and Respiratory Infections (21 papers), Respiratory viral infections research (15 papers) and Pneumocystis jirovecii pneumonia detection and treatment (9 papers). Allison Thompson is often cited by papers focused on Pneumonia and Respiratory Infections (21 papers), Respiratory viral infections research (15 papers) and Pneumocystis jirovecii pneumonia detection and treatment (9 papers). Allison Thompson collaborates with scholars based in United States, Germany and United Kingdom. Allison Thompson's co-authors include Daniel A. Scott, William C. Gruber, Emilio A. Emini, Wendy Watson, Kathrin U. Jansen, Scott D. Patterson, Ingrid L. Scully, Alejandra Gurtman, Nicola Principi and John Ginis and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Clinical Oncology, PEDIATRICS and The Journal of Urology.
